RedKalion

Kenzo Okada - Solstice - 1954 75x100 cm / 30x40inches Fine Art Poster

Kenzo Okada - Solstice - 1954 75x100 cm / 30x40inches Fine Art Poster

Regular price $207.99 USD
Regular price $311.00 USD Sale price $207.99 USD
Sale Sold out
Quantity
View full details